首頁 >web前端 >前端問答 >如何使用jQuery改變div的寬度

如何使用jQuery改變div的寬度

PHPz
PHPz原創
2023-04-10 09:47:41953瀏覽

jQuery是一種JavaScript函式庫,可以幫助開發人員寫更簡潔、更快速的程式碼。在Web應用程式的開發中,jQuery是一個不可或缺的工具。本文將介紹如何使用jQuery改變div的寬度。

首先,我們需要在HTML頁面中引入jQuery函式庫。可以透過以下方式來引入:

<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>

這將使我們的頁面具備使用jQuery庫的能力。

接下來,我們需要在CSS中加入樣式,設定需要改變寬度的div的初始寬度。例如:

div {
    width: 100px;
}

現在,我們可以使用jQuery來改變div的寬度。可以使用以下程式碼:

$(document).ready(function(){
  $("button").click(function(){
    $("div").animate({width: "400px"}, 1000);
  });
});

解釋一下上面的程式碼:

  • 當頁面已經載入完畢後,使用$(document).ready()函數。
  • 當點擊按鈕時,執行一個函數。
  • 在函數中,使用animate()函數來改變div的寬度。
  • 第一個參數是一個對象,包含要改變的CSS屬性及其目標值。
  • 第二個參數是動畫的持續時間,以毫秒為單位。

上述程式碼將使div的寬度從100px增加到400px,並在1秒鐘內進行動畫效果。

如果想要以目前寬度為基礎,增加或減少一定的像素,可以使用以下程式碼:

$("div").width(function(index, width){
  return width + 50;
});

這將將div的寬度增加50像素。

總結

在本文中,我們介紹如何使用jQuery改變div的寬度。這可以透過使用jQuery的animate()函數和width()函數來實現。使用jQuery庫,我們能夠非常方便地編寫介面動畫,使得頁面體驗更加流暢、美觀。

以上是如何使用jQuery改變div的寬度的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n